What is gardening?  Quite simply, it involves refraining from applying for new credit or seeking CLIs that require hard pulls. Soft pulls CLIs, however, are not only acceptable, but are encouraged. The idea is to allow one's current TLs to grow and mature, waiting for inqs to age or fall off, and possibly waiting for "baddies" to be removed or age off. During this time, one tends to one's current accounts and watches their AAoA grow and the new credit ding fade.

Garden Club recognition levels: To qualify, your reports must contain:

No new tradelines of any type on one's accounts (this includes backdated Amex accounts, as they are STILL new "seedlings").
No HPs for anything that would allow for the possibility of a new tradeline being issued or increasing the CL of an existing tradeline.

*The Garden Club community recognizes that certain inquiries are necessary for factors beyond those listed above. Therefore, Hard Pulls/Inquiries for the following bona fide reasons are exempt but not limited to: Opening checking/savings accounts (so long as no line of credit is being opened in addition to these accounts), Employment Applications, Apartment Rentals, Utilities and other such services. These are not considered to be applications for credit per se.

You will be able to add the following to your siggy if you have abided by the above for the following time periods...


Less than 1 month - seedling

1 month - bronze spade

3 months - silver spade

6 months - gold spade

 

9 months - palladium spade

12 months - platinum spade

 

15 months - ruby spade

 

18 months - emerald spade

 

21 months - sapphire spade

24 months or more - diamond spade


Please note: recognition levels reset once you add an account or incur a HP.
